UNC, NC State football searching for end to ACC title drought. Is this the year?
Posted Jul 29, 2024
For once, Mack Brown and his program enter a season without the familiar buzz. That belongs, now, to N.C. State, with its revamped offense, led by transfer quarterback Grayson McCall, and a defense that lost its best playmaker in Payton Wilson but not, the hope goes, its culture or identity. Like UNC, though, the Wolfpack hasn’t exactly handled expectations.
